NO. 3067-0077 ELEVATION CERTIFICATE `� ��� Expires May31, 1996 FEDERAL EMERGENCY MANAGEMENT AGENCY NATIONAL FLOOD INSURANCE PROGRAM ATTENTION: Use of this certificate does not provide a waiver of the flood insurance purchase requirement. This form is used only to provide elevation information necessary to ensure compliance with applicable community floodplain management ordinances, to determine the proper insurance premium rate, and/or to support a request for a Letter of Map Amendment or Revision (LOMA or LOMR). DJACENT:: ' r.::.:.,'t: �.,:.:: •�. ,,,f1 GRADE The diagrams above illustrate the points at which the elevations should be measured in A Zones and V Zones. Elevations for all A Zones should be measured at the top of the reference level floor. Elevations for all V Zones should be measured at the bottom of the lowest horizontal structural member. Construct on shall follow "standard Building Code} as adopted by the county and as applicable to the area in which the building is to be constructed with all applicable amendments. 2. The Contractor, Subcontractor, Supplier, etc. shall verify ali dimensions, conditions at 3obsite, plans, specifications, etc. 3. All written dimensions on these drawings take precedence over scaled dimensions. 4. Structural features not detailed on these plans will be addressed by the Engineer as construction progresses. STRUCTURAL NOTES 1. Design Loads: Roof (DL + LL) a 47 PSF wind Velocity " 110 MPH supporting structure 120 MPH roof system - Truss Mean Height " 15 ft above grade 2. Soil bearing capacity : 2500 PSF 3. All structural concrete and grout shall have a minimum compressive strength of 3000 PSI at 28 days. 4. Slab/Footings to be concrete with minimum 2500 PSI compressive strength at 28 days. See plans for size and steel requirements. 5. Minimum concrete Drotection for reinforcing bars: footings: 3" Beams: 1-1/2" Suspended Slabs: 1" - 6. Lap all reinforcing steel aminimum of 30 bar diameters. 7. All standard lumber shall be SPF 03, HF 13, or Stud Grade vith a minimum Fb=1200 psi, or better. 8. All Lumber in contact with concrete or masonry shall be pressure treated. 9. Splitting or cracking of structural components due to Installation of hardware is not permitted. - 10.Unless otherwise noted, the installation of specified hardware shall conform to the manufacturers instructions and standard practice. ll.Bearing points of headers, girders, and beams shall have vertical supports sufficient to support loads and shall be properly anchored for uplift as will be noted. 12.Roof sheathing to be nailed with 10d Galv. nails or equal 6" o.c.
